Montenegrin chess player Predrag Nikač drew with Aleksej Streltsov from Israel in the eighth round of the World Singles Championship for people without and with visual impairments in Rhodes.

It is his first draw in the championship, after six wins and losses.

The Dutch defense was played, and Strelotsov decided after 50 moves of the fight to lead the game to a draw with eternal Chess.

With that draw, Nikač kept second place before the last round.

Nikač has half a point more than the group of five players, and in tomorrow's last, ninth round, he needs a positive result to win a medal.

Nikač is accompanied by FIDE master Nenad Aleksić in Rhodes.
